Summary

Edward Frederic Benson (1867-1940) was an English novelist, biographer, memoirist, archaeologist, and short story writer, best known for his masterly and uncanny ghost stories. One of the most famous of these is "The Bus Conductor". It is a deceptively simple tale of a mysterious apparition which comes into view on an ordinary London street under most peculiar circumstances. The chilling catchphrase spoken by the mysterious figure: "Just room for one inside, Sir" takes on an altogether sinister meaning.
